PROGRAM RECOGNITION
BA Theatre major in The Alice Stout Edwards School of Performing Arts
52-credit curriculum centered on acting, stagecraft, design, directing, theatre history, script analysis, and production work
TRAINING
Required work includes vocal and movement training, stagecraft, dramatic structure, scene design, acting, directing, and Business of the Performing Arts
Collateral choices let students add dance, music, art, photography, sound, literature, or design-related coursework
PERFORMANCE & PRODUCTIONS
Theatre department produces four productions per year, including at least one major musical
Students can participate in acting, singing, dancing, directing, choreography, sound and light design, stage management, costuming, and makeup
Student-directed showcases happen in the intimate James L. Meikle Crossover Theatre
LOCATION
Campus sits just south of Branson, with access to regional professional theatre and entertainment opportunities
VALUE
Full-time students receive Tuition Assurance and do not pay tuition
Work Education Program is part of the College's debt-free model
